Cultural Methods of Weed Control in St. Augustine Grass Lawns. Having a healthy lawn is the first and most important step to weed control. Performing regular maintenance practices like mowing, fertilizing and irrigation helps promote healthy growth. Mowing at the right times and at an appropriate height of 2–4 inches is ideal. The number of pieces of sod per pallet changes by the farm harvesting it. Farms that use smaller pieces of sod will have more rolls or slabs per pallet, but often the square footage is similar from one pallet to the next. Bitterblue has a darker blue-green color than the common St. Augustine. Bitter blue has a good cold tolerance. We are one of the few sod growers that can produce Bitterblue because of it’s poor tolerance to atrazine and other weed chemicals. They all require …Jan 8, 2023 · An established St. Augustine lawn has a high tolerance to shade, but newly planted grass won’t grow well in those conditions. New grass growing in shady conditions will grow in thin and spindly, and you won’t end up with the thick St. Augustine lawn that you want. St. Augustine needs 4 to 6 hours of sun to grow best. St. Augustine grass is a low growing, dark green grass, with broad, flat blades. It is mainly found in tropical and sub tropical areas along the gulf coast, Caribbean, and Mediterranean. Floratam St. Augustine grass was found to be better than Common for the following reasons: It has resistance to SAD virus. 2. It has resistance to chinch bugs. (sort-of) 3. Between these two, St. Augustine is typically on the pricier side with an average cost per square foot of $0.70.On a per pallet basis, which is usually how sod is sold, this comes out to roughly $350.00 per pallet.. Bahia on the other hand, is a more moderately priced at $0.45 per square foot (on average).
